163 WWUS75 KREV 030948 NPWREV URGENT - WEATHER MESSAGE National Weather Service Reno NV 148 AM PST Sat Jan 3 2026 CAZ070-041500- /O.NEW.KREV.WI.Y.0001.260103T2100Z-260104T1500Z/ Surprise Valley California- Including the cities of Cedarville, Fort Bidwell, and Eagleville 148 AM PST Sat Jan 3 2026 ...WIND ADVISORY IN EFFECT FROM 1 PM THIS AFTERNOON TO 7 AM PST SUNDAY... * WHAT...South winds 20 to 35 mph with gusts up to 55 mph. Wind prone areas could see gusts as high as 65 mph. * WHERE...Surprise Valley California. * WHEN...From 1 PM this afternoon to 7 AM PST Sunday. * IMPACTS...Gusty winds will blow around unsecured objects. Tree limbs could be blown down and a few power outages may result. P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... Now is the time to secure loose outdoor items such as patio furniture, holiday decorations, and trash cans before winds increase which could blow these items away. The best thing to do is prepare ahead of time by making sure you have extra food and water on hand, flashlights with spare batteries and/or candles in the event of a power outage. Winds this strong can make driving difficult, especially for high profile vehicles.
